Overview

AtkinsRéalis is growing and our Atlantic Canada Engineering group is seeking an Intermediate Electrical Engineer to join our growing Electrical Engineering team. Reporting to the Senior Electrical Team Lead, you will support the execution of a wide variety of electrical projects by collaborating with a team of engineers, technologists, and technicians. This position provides for on-going career advancement including developing technical expertise, gain team leadership skills and exposure to project management and client facing roles with in-house training and support.

Our Engineering Services team in Halifax is dynamic and tight‑knit, servicing local projects while contributing to large national and international projects as part of distributed virtual project teams. Our projects are varied and span Healthcare, National Defence, Light + Heavy Industrial, Transportation (Rail + Transit, Ports + Marines), Municipal, Federal (including Defence + Nuclear), and Institutional industries.

Your Role
  • Preparation of electrical single line diagrams, AC control schematics, wiring distribution schemes, panel schedules. Development of cable block diagrams, cable and conduit schedules. Design of physical layout of electrical equipment, cables, raceways, and grounding plans related to the various facilities within the plant. Coordination studies and arc flash calculations. Perform site inspections and technical support during construction activities.

  • Collaborate with Engineers, Designers and CAD Technicians, provide tasking and guidance to junior and support staff towards project execution. Support the Electrical Team Lead in adhering project deliverables to meet electrical department methods and quality procedures aligned with corporate standards.

  • Participate in providing input to engineering level of effort estimates and proposal content to support business development.

  • Build and maintain strong internal and external client relationships to support business growth and ensure client satisfaction.

  • Drive continuous improvement in processes, tools, and project delivery efficiency.

About you
  • Bachelor's Degree in Electrical Engineering. Registered as a Professional Engineer (P. Eng) with an engineering association of an Atlantic Canada province.

  • PMP designation or CAPM certification is an asset.

  • Minimum 3-6 years' of relevant experience in Electrical Engineering consulting with technical knowledge of building and site electrical systems.

  • Strong knowledge of electrical engineering principles and relevant industry standards.

  • Demonstrable experience building and maintaining relationships with clients (i.e. understanding client objectives, anticipating, and meeting client needs, and growing our business).

  • Experience supervising and tasking junior support staff.

  • Willing to travel occasionally within and outside of Nova Scotia.

  • Excellent communication, problem‑solving, and interpersonal skills.

  • Ability to apply and obtain security clearances required by various client agencies.
